4 Youths Wanted for Scrawling ‘Hamas’ and Swastikas on Upper East Side

NEW YORK — The NYPD has released photos of four teen-aged suspects wanted for allegedly scrawling antisemitic graffiti on Manhattan’s Upper East Side last month.
On October 9, two days after Hamas massacred some 1,200 Jews in Israel — mostly civilians and some in barbaric fashion — the four male youths allegedly drew graffiti on the rooftops of four buildings in the vicinity of East 85th Street and 3rd Avenue. A source told Hamodia the graffiti included “Hamas” and swastikas.
